A rounded, monoline sans with soft terminals and gently squarish curves. Proportions run on the compact side, with tall ascenders/descenders and a slightly bouncy rhythm created by subtly varied widths and humanistic drawing. Counters are open and clean, joins are smooth, and the overall silhouette favors pill-shaped strokes over sharp corners, keeping letterforms sturdy and legible.
Well-suited to short-to-medium text where a friendly voice is desired, such as UI labels, app onboarding, packaging, café/retail signage, and upbeat editorial callouts. It also works nicely for posters and social graphics where compact letterforms and rounded shapes help maintain clarity at larger sizes.
The font reads warm and personable, with a lighthearted, everyday tone. Its softened geometry and slightly irregular, hand-drawn feel suggest friendliness rather than strict neutrality, making text feel conversational and welcoming.
Likely designed as a personable, rounded sans that balances clarity with charm. The intention appears to be an accessible display-to-text option that softens the tone of messaging while preserving straightforward, readable forms.
Uppercase forms stay simple and rounded, while lowercase shows more character in shapes like the single-storey-style forms and looped descenders, contributing to an informal texture in paragraphs. Numerals match the same soft, compact construction and maintain consistent stroke presence alongside letters.
